URGENT REMINDER REGARDING MEDICATIONS: If your student requires lifesaving medications, such as an Epipen or an asthma inhaler, these must be provided to us with a medical release by your student's doctor. 


If your student's medication becomes expired during the school year, they will not be allowed to attend school until non-expired medications with doctors orders can be brought to campus. We will try our best to remind families when medications are about to expire. You can help us by providing keeping track of the expiration dates for your student's prescriptions. This will help use to keep your student safe and to avoid missing any school.

CLASS LISTS
Class list for Fall 2023 will be posted at the building the week of August 28th. You will also receive a welcome letter from your child's teacher. We believe in the quality of all our teachers. Our teachers work closely together through their PLC meetings. Our teachers use the same core curriculum and they assess students using the same standards-based assessments. They share the responsibility of equitable student success across the grade. When we draft class rosters we strive to create diverse classroom communities. For these reasons, we do not take requests for specific teachers. However, your input is important to us as a partner in your child's schooling.
